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Newcourt to Hope (Derbyshire) start from as little as £33.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Newcourt to Hope (Derbyshire) are available for £186.90 one way, or £373.70 return

Everything you need to know about Newcourt Station

Welcome to Newcourt Train Station!

Located in the charming city of Exeter, Newcourt train station is a small yet crucial part of Devon's rail network. As the city continues to grow and attract visitors, this station remains an essential link for both commuters and leisure travelers. Whether you're planning a day trip or a longer journey, understanding Newcourt's facilities and connections will help you make the most of your travels.

Facilities and Amenities at Newcourt

Newcourt train station offers a range of facilities to meet your travel needs. While there's no ticket office, automated ticket machines are available for convenience. These machines are accessible, ensuring that all passengers can easily obtain their tickets. An induction loop is also in place, making the station more accommodating for those with hearing impairments.

Although staff assistance isn't available, there are help points to provide necessary information to travelers. CCTV cameras ensure passenger safety throughout the station, giving you peace of mind during your visit. Step-free access allows everyone to navigate the station with ease. However, keep in mind that there are no public toilets, refreshment facilities, or bicycle storage at Newcourt.

Onward Travel Options

For those interested in continuing their journey beyond the rails, Newcourt station is conveniently connected to local bus services, with bus stops located by the Community Centre for easy transfers. Although there are no designated taxi ranks or car hire services directly at the station, additional transport options can be found nearby. Make sure you plan ahead to smoothly transition between modes of transport.

Everything you need to know about Hope (Derbyshire) Station

Welcome to Hope (Derbyshire) Train Station

Nestled within the scenic vistas of the Peak District, Hope (Derbyshire) train station serves as a quaint yet pivotal stop on your railway journey. Often cherished for its natural beauty, the village of Hope is surrounded by lush landscapes and offers a slice of serenity away from the hustle and bustle of urban life. Whether you're planning on exploring the Peak District National Park or simply making a stop along the way to cities like Sheffield or Manchester, Hope station provides vital transport connections that are key to many travelers' plans.

Station Facilities and Amenities

The facilities at Hope (Derbyshire) might be limited, but they ensure a seamless travel experience for all passengers. Although there isn't a ticket office, ticket machines are available for purchasing and collecting pre-booked tickets, with accessible machines conveniently located in the station car park. There’s also an induction loop in place to aid hearing-impaired travelers.

While the station doesn't have a waiting room or refreshment facilities, a seating area is available for passengers’ comfort. Unfortunately, there are no essential amenities like toilets or a lounge, so plan accordingly before and after your journey. The absence of shops and an ATM might leave some wanting, so it's recommended to come prepared.

Transport Links for Your Journey

Despite its remote charm, Hope (Derbyshire)’s connectivity is more robust than one might expect. The station provides a rail replacement service, which is instrumental during disruptions. For those looking to explore the local areas, bus services are readily available, and bicycle hire can be arranged through Alive Bike Hire, offering you a wonderful way to explore the neighbouring countryside.

Even though taxis aren't on call at the station, services can be booked through Cab4You for those requiring a private hire service directly to or from the station. This means you’re never far from reaching Hope’s station or continuing your onward journey with ease.
